Anisotropic thermopower in the a-b plane of an untwinned YBa2Cu3O7-δ crystal

We have measured the thermopower of an untwinned crystal of YBa2Cu3O7-δ in both the a and b directions. In the a direction the thermopower is about +0.7 μV/K just above Tc, while in the b direction the thermopower is opposite in sign and -6 μV/K. The sharp peak observed at Tc in twinned crystals is only clearly present in the a-axis measurement. At temperatures close to room temperature the a-axis thermopower becomes temperature independent and very small. It is argued that the peak is evidence of superconducting fluctuation effects in the thermopower
